A Randomized, Double-blind, Placebo-controlled Trial of Using Red Yeast Rice, Phytosterol Esters and Lycopene in Combination for Regulating Lipid Metabolism of Guangzhou Individuals With Dyslipidemia

The objective of this study is to evaluate the effect of using red yeast rice, phytosterol esters and lycopene in combination for 12 weeks on improving the glycolipid metabolism of Guangzhou individuals with dyslipidemia. Our hypothesis is that when compared with placebo, red yeast rice, phytosterol esters and lycopene together as supplements would lead to greater improvements in lipid metabolism (including lipid profiles and parameters ) in participants after 12 weeks.
